Camerimage 2001

Already for the ninth time CAMERIMAGE has successfully closed. With extreme joy we would like to share with you the first hand account on what happened in Łódź, Poland between 1-8 December. Polish Prime Minister, the Local Authorities, Polish Ministry of Culture and the President of Polish State Film Committee honoured us with their patronage upon the event. At this point it is crucial to pay special recognition to our sponsors who made CAMERIMAGE 2001 happen. For this exceptional occasion we utter effusive "thank you" towards distributors, producers, associations and private people without who the Festival would be deprived of substantial part of its celebrity. Thank you all !!!

The International Jury composed of: Jorg Schmidt - Reitwein, Robert Fraisse, Phedon Papamichael, Sean Bobbitt and presided by Roger Deakins spent seven hard days watching and judging 14 films presented in this part: MULHOLLAND DRIVE - USA Cinematographer - Peter Deming Director - David Lynch DESERT MOON - JAPAN Cinematographer - Tamra Masaki Director - Aoyama Shinji HEARTS IN ATLANTIS - USA Cinematographer - Piotr Sobociński Director - Scott Hicks BUFFALO SOLDIERS - UK, USA, GERMANY Cinematographer - Oliver Stapleton Director - Gregor Jordan THE WARRIOR - ENGLAND, INDIA Cinematographer - Roman Osin Director - Asif Kapadia THE STREETERS - MEXICO Cinematographer - Hector Ortega Director - Gerardo Tort ANGELUS - POLAND Cinematographer - Adam Sikora Director - Lech Majewski NO MAN'S LAND - FRANCE, ITALY, BELGIUM, SLOVENIA, UK Cinematographer - Walther Vanden Ende Director - Danis Tanovic SHADOW OF THE VAMPIRE - USA, UK, LUXEMBOURG Cinematographer - Lou Bouge Director - Elias Merhiage L'AMOUR, L'ARGENT, L'AMOUR - GERMANY Cinematographers - Sophie Maintigneux, Max Jonathan Silberstein Director - Philip Gröning KITES OVER HELSINKI - FINLAND Cinematographer - Kjell Lagerroos Director - Peter Lindholm THE PROFESSION OF ARMS - ITALY Cinematographer - Fabio Olmi Director - Ermanno Olmi THE PIANO TEACHER - AUSTRIA, FRANCE Cinematographer - Christian Berger Director - Michael Haneke KING IS DANCING - FRANCE Cinematographer - Gerard Simon Director - Gerard Corbiau The cinematographers competed for Golden, Silver and Bronze Frog. This year's Camerimage Lifetime Achievement Award went to one of the greatest cinematographers Owen Roizman, A.S.C. The Retrospective was a parallel section where some of Owen Roizman's most illustrious films were presented: The French Connection - directed by William Friedkin The Exorcist (2000) - directed by William Friedkin Wyatt Earp - directed by Larry Kasdan True Confessions - directed by Ulu Grosbard Grand Canyon - directed by Larry Kasdan Three Days of the Condor - directed by Sydney Pollack The "Frog embodied" Award was granted to Mr Roizman during the Closing Ceremony on Saturday, December 8th. At this extremely glorious event we witnessed the unique scene of Vittorio Storaro, Vilmos Zsigmond and Billy Williams granting the Award to Owen Roizman. Sydney Pollack, Roizman's close friend, having not been able to attend the gala, sent a very warm letter to be read out in public and in a sense mark his presence at this momentous Ceremony. Festival attracting professional cinematographers is as well tempting for students. The particular character of CAMERIMAGE gave them another chance of active participation in the event just shoulder to shoulder with their masters. Students presented their short works to the audience but certainly the most thrilling aspect for them was the fact that their films were judged by the same International Jury with special presence of John Mathieson. Students, representing almost 30 Schools from more than 20 countries, showed 18 films in the Competition and 22 in the World Panorama. The shorts competed for Golden, Silver and Bronze Tadpole. Together with Opus Film Studio from Łódź we prepared professional workshops, where students had the exceptional opportunity to see the masters of vision at home revealing the secrets of their craft and talking about their experiences. The workshops attracted more then 400 students each time. On the first-day-workshops students spent exciting hours with Owen Roizman (working with Panavision camera) and Billy Williams following the next day. A few days passed and in one of Łódź cinemas Billy Williams' workshops were presented as a documentary. Also Arri Lighting Workshops were arranged to show students Oliver Stapleton and John Mathieson playing the light and shadow game. This year's workshops were incomparable in size to those from the past. Two words are enough to describe the results - absolute victory and applause. The students as well as the regular audience had the chance to attend engaging seminars by Paul Mazursky, Jost Vacano, Vittorio Storaro, John Mathieson, Andrzej Wajda and Roman Osin. Honoris Causa Doctorate of Lodz Film School was granted to the great master of light - Vittorio Storaro. That was the first doctorate in the school's history ever granted to a cinematographer. Tribute to Piotr Sobociński In co-operation with the Museum of Film and Lodz Film School, to pay an honour to our beloved friend, we organised Tribute to Piotr Sobociński. On Sunday, December 2nd in Piotrkowska Street, the Star Alley in Lodz, new one - Piotr Sobociński's Star had its unveiling. Furthermore, during the Festival the audience had a chance to see some of his previous and latest films in the Retrospective:
  • Hearts in Atlantis
  • The Rat Catcher
  • Three Colours: Red
  • The Seventh Room
  • Ransom
  • Angel Eyes
This exceptional idea within the Festival has created, from now on, the possibility of having Piotr with us for all future CAMERIMAGE editions.
GOLDEN FROG GERARD SIMON - KING IS DANCINGSILVER FROG ADAM SIKORA - ANGELUSBRONZE FROG PIOTR SOBOCIŃSKI - HEARTS IN ATLANTISThe audience honoured Mr F.A.Brabec with the laurel for the film WILD FLOWERS, which he both shot and directed.GOLDEN TADPOLE SŁAWOMIR BERGAŃSKI - KIMERIA National Lodz Film School - Poland SILVER TADPOLE CARLOS CATALAN ALUCHA - PREY Escola Superior De Cinema I Audiovisuals De Catalunya - Spain BRONZE TADPOLE PETER FLINCKENBERG - ZERO DEGREES Department of Film and Television Helsinki - Finland Honorary Golden Frog Piotr Sobociński Camerimage Special Award from Cinematographers to an Actor for Visual Valor of Work John Malkovich Polish Film Award given by the Prime Minister of the Republic of Poland Joel Coen Special Camerimage Award to a Team for Outstanding Achievements in the Field of the Art of Cinematography Joel & Ethan Coen & Roger Deakins During the Closing Ceremony we also granted the Frogs from the previous year as we were honoured to host the recipients at the Festival: SILVER FROG 2000 ROBERT FRAISSE - VATEL - FRANCE Bronze Frog 2000 PHILIP ØGAARD - ABERDEEN - NORWAY
To sum up, the IX edition of the International Film Festival of the Art of Cinematography - CAMERIMAGE was very successful. More than 20 000 Lodz inhabitants visited the Festival Centre within the Festival week. We have also hosted over 700 students and about 200 cinematographers from all over the world. We find it noteworthy that almost each film, both in Competition, World Panorama and Special Screenings, had at least cinematographer or director present. We were given the favour to spend wonderful time with the greatest of the movie industry, who accepted our invitation to come to Poland just to be part of CAMERIMAGE's magic atmosphere. The City of Lodz, for the second time, was the witness of the film celebration and hosted such great personalities as: Joel Coen, Paul Mazursky, Andrzej Wajda, Andrzej Żuławski, Robert Gliński, Asif Kapadia, John Malkovich, Vittorio Storaro, Owen Roizman, Billy Williams, Roger Deakins, Vilmos Zsigmond, Tibor Vagyoczky, Robert Fraisse, Jorg Schmidt - Reitwein, Phedon Papamichael, Sean Bobbitt, John Mathieson, Jost Vacano, Wolfgang Treu, Oliver Stapleton, Witold Sobociński, Zbigniew Wichłacz, Adam Sikora, Petro Aleksowski, Piotr Kukla, Roman Osin, Haris Zambarloukos, Hector Ortega, Walther Vanden Ende, Septimu Moraru, Kjell Lagerroos, Philip Ogaard, Fabio Olmi, Christian Berger, Gerard Simon, Robert Alazraki, Rudiger Leske and many, many others, whose names are not imprinted in CAMERIMAGE's records, but definitely CAMERIMAGE has been engraved in their hearts.
